The Art and Science of Precision Spinning
Precision spinning, also known as metal spinning, is a specialized manufacturing process used to form hollow, axisymmetric parts. Unlike traditional machining processes that remove material, spinning utilizes plastic deformation to shape metal sheets over a mandrel. This results in significant material savings, reduced waste, and the ability to create complex geometries with exceptional accuracy. The process begins with a flat metal blank, which is then rotated at high speed while a forming tool gradually applies pressure, forcing the material to conform to the shape of the mandrel. The skill lies in controlling the force, speed, and tooling to achieve the desired dimensions and material properties. Material Selection and Its Impact
Choosing the right material is a critical step in the spinning process. Different metals possess unique characteristics in terms of strength, ductility, corrosion resistance, and cost. For example, aerospace components often require high-strength, lightweight alloys like titanium or aluminum, while medical devices may necessitate biocompatible stainless steel. | Material | Common Applications | Key Properties |
|---|---|---|
| Aluminum | Aerospace, Automotive, Lighting | Lightweight, Corrosion Resistant, Good Conductivity |
| Stainless Steel | Medical, Food Processing, Chemical | Corrosion Resistant, High Strength, Hygienic |
| Steel | Industrial, Heavy Machinery, Construction | High Strength, Durability, Cost-Effective |
| Copper | Electrical Components, Plumbing, Heat Exchangers | Excellent Conductivity, Malleability, Corrosion Resistance |
The selection process isn’t just about the metal itself, but also the specific alloy and its temper.
